What is the total cost for a $100 dinner plus 20% tip plus 8% sales tax

$129.6

you do 100 times .08 and get 8 so 100 + 8 = 108
then you do 108 times .20 and get 21.6 so 108 + 21.6 = 129.6

The sum of two numbers is 61 and the difference is 3 what are the numbers
madam [21]

Answer:

<h3>29 and 32</h3>

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x = number

Let y = second number

We know that there are two true equations from this. Here is shown below the equations.

x + y = 61

x + 3  = y

We could use the substitution method for finding the numbers. After that, we continue on to solve to find the first number.

x + (x+3) = 61

2x + 3 = 61

2x = 58

2x/2 = 58/2

x = 29

Now that we know that the first number is 29, plug it in to the second equation to find the second number.

x + 3 = y

29 + 3 = y

y = 32

Proof that these numbers are the correct answer:

32 + 29 = 61

61 = 61 (Which is true!)

eric and sue buy some gifts for a friend. eric pays £3.50. they pay in the ratio 5:3 how much does sue pay?
kotegsom [21]

Answer:

£1.31

Step-by-step explanation:

Add 5 to 3, obtaining 8.  Then the amt tht Eric pays is 5/8 of the £3.50 total, and the amt tht Sue pays is 3/8 of the total.

Thus, mult. £3.50 by 3/8:

(3/8)(£3.50) = £1.31 (which has been rounded off from £1.3125).
